The Process of a Cabinet Refinish

If your kitchen cabinets, or other cabinets in your house, need some new life to them, call Brett. The process of refinishing a set of cabinets takes about 5-8 days, but ultimately, is dependent on the size of the space and the number of cabinets. Here’s a quick look at how those 5-8 days will go:

  • Disassembly: To start out, Brett will come in and take out the existing cabinets and get everything set up for the work that needs to be done.
  • Prep Work: Once the space is ready, the next couple of days are spent sanding and masking to ensure your cabinets are in tip-top condition before adding any product to them.
  • Priming & Painting: Once your cabinets are smooth, a couple coats of primer will be put on them, so they last a long time. After priming, the cabinets are ready for a topcoat of Four Seasons Premium Products that are sure to last a long time.
  • Reassembly: Brett takes care of ensuring your cabinets are properly installed back in your house to show off that new look.

If you have a preference for the products you want on your cabinets, Brett is all ears, but if you need a recommendation, you can trust his knowledge! He uses only top-of-the-line products that are made to last. His go-to’s for topcoats are Sherwin Williams, Emerald Urethane, and Benjamin Moore Advance. These products are water-based and will be just what you need in your kitchen. Oil-based products used to be the standard, but the quality of water-based products has skyrocketed so many experts prefer them now.
